Using Thermal Imaging to Identify Leak Areas

Our leak detection process starts with advanced thermal imaging. This technology detects temperature variations in walls and floors, showing cooler areas in shades of blue and warmer areas in shades of red. Cooler areas can indicate potential water leaks and help us identify where moisture may be present.

By identifying these temperature differences, we can focus our inspection more effectively, minimising unnecessary exploration and damage to your property.

Measuring Moisture Levels in Walls and Floors

To further assess potential leak areas, we use advanced moisture meters to measure moisture levels within walls and floors. This provides precise readings, helping us determine the extent of water intrusion and whether further investigation or repairs may be needed.

By cross-referencing these moisture readings with our thermal and sonic detection results, we can provide a more complete assessment of the affected areas.

Tracer Dye Leak Detection

 

Tracer Dye Leak Detection is a precise and effective method for identifying leaks in plumbing, roofs and other water-related areas. By introducing a non-toxic, biodegradable fluorescent dye into suspected areas, we can trace water pathways with high accuracy.

When illuminated with UV light, the dye glows, revealing hidden leaks. This technique is especially useful for detecting leaks in hard-to-reach places such as behind walls and under floors.

Tracer dye detection can help identify the source of a leak, prevent further damage and reduce unnecessary repair costs.
